Wednesday, August 13, 2009 - noon: The Albert Loop Trail is officially closed for public safety to avoid potential bear encounters. As the salmon return to their spawning grounds, so too, do the bears to feed on the salmon and the berries. Closing this popular trail for a few months has been a successful way to reduce people-bear conflicts. For more information, contact Chugach State Park at 907-345-5014. For a list of other public forum locations and dates, please visit http://dnr.alaska.gov/parks/ ERNC Scope of Objectives (8-2009) Site Location Descriptions (8-2009) August 2008- August 2009: Thanks to a generous Tier 1 grant from the Rasmuson Foundation, the Nature Center was able to purchase much-needed equipment to maintain the trails and grounds. The funds allowed the ERNC to purchase an ATV with winch, a belly dump for spreading gravel, bear-proof food lockers for the public-use cabin and yurts, bear-proof recycling containers, D1 gravel, interpretive supplies, and more.
